World Cup re-writes itself day by day and is great. So here’s another new record was set on the 74th minute of Mexico vs. Sweden game when defender Edson Alvarez scored an own-goal. You say no big deal but it is – it was 7th own-goal of the tournament which is one more than 6 own-goals record set in 1998. So we have a big chance to see a bigger margin really soon.

Same evening Switzerland goalkeeper Yann Sommer scored an own-goal during the clash with Costa Rica (2:2) and historically became third goalie who past the ball behind himself at the World Cup game. Ouch!

  • Also 2018 World Cup set new record series of games without goalless draws (36) and seen more penalties than ever before as well
